Selected Verse: Deuteronomy 14:21 - King James
Verse |
Translation |
Text |
De 14:21 |
King James |
Ye shall not eat of any thing that dieth of itself: thou shalt give it unto the stranger that is in thy gates, that he may eat it; or thou mayest sell it unto an alien: for thou art an holy people unto the LORD thy God. Thou shalt not seethe a kid in his mother's milk. |
Summary Of Commentaries Associated With The Selected Verse
A Commentary, Critical, Practical, and Explanatory on the Old and New Testaments, by Robert Jamieson, A.R. Fausset and David Brown [1882] |
Ye shall not eat of any thing that dieth of itself--(See on Lev 17:15; Lev 22:8).
thou shalt give it unto the stranger that is in thy gates--not a proselyte, for he, as well as an Israelite, was subject to this law; but a heathen traveller or sojourner.
Thou shalt not seethe a kid in his mother's milk--This is the third place in which the prohibition is repeated [Exo 23:19; Exo 34:26]. It was pointed against an annual pagan ceremony (see on Exo 23:19; Exo 34:26).

Adam Clarke Commentary on the Whole Bible - Published 1810-1826 |
Thou shalt not seethe a kid in his mother's milk - Mr.
Calmet thinks that this precept refers to the paschal lamb only, which was not to be offered to God till it was weaned from its mother; but see the note on Exo 23:19. |
